Astronomer Clifford Stoll shows off a big, beautiful mechanical adding machine from 1895 in a new Numberphile video.
"Long before transistors and other electronics came along, calculators were large mechanical machines that performed mathematics through a series of gears and cylinders turning inside their boxy exteriors. The YouTube channel called the Numberphile got its hands on one such device called the 'Millionaire,' and released a video
